数控系统编程是现代制造业中不可或缺的关键技术,它涉及计算机辅助设计(CAD)和计算机辅助制造(CAM)等多个领域。在本文中,我们将从专业角度深入探讨数控系统编程的要点,旨在为从业人员提供有价值的参考。
数控系统编程的核心是编写G代码,G代码是数控机床进行加工的指令集。G代码的编写需要遵循一定的规则和标准,如ISO 100791:2003《机械加工——数控——编程——G代码》。以下是数控系统编程的关键要点:
1. 熟悉数控机床的结构和功能。数控机床的种类繁多,不同型号的机床具有不同的结构和功能。编程人员需要熟悉所使用的机床,了解其工作原理、运动轨迹和加工范围。
2. 熟悉CAD/CAM软件。CAD/CAM软件是数控编程的基础,编程人员需要熟练掌握CAD/CAM软件的操作,如UG、SolidWorks、Mastercam等。通过CAD/CAM软件,可以将设计图纸转化为G代码。
3. 确定加工工艺。加工工艺是数控编程的重要依据,包括加工材料、刀具、切削参数、加工顺序等。编程人员需要根据加工要求,合理选择加工工艺,确保加工质量。
4. 编写G代码。G代码是数控机床进行加工的指令集,包括直线、圆弧、刀具补偿、固定循环等。编写G代码时,应注意以下几点:
(1)遵循ISO 100791:2003标准,确保G代码的正确性。
(2)合理设置刀具路径,避免刀具碰撞和加工缺陷。
(3)优化加工参数,提高加工效率和精度。
(4)考虑加工安全,避免发生意外事故。
5. 模拟和调试。在编写G代码后,应进行模拟和调试,以确保编程的正确性和加工质量。模拟和调试过程中,应注意以下几点:
(1)检查G代码的语法和逻辑错误。
(2)验证刀具路径和加工参数是否合理。
(3)观察加工效果,调整加工参数,直至达到预期效果。
6. 编程规范。为了提高编程效率和加工质量,编程人员应养成良好的编程规范,如:
(1)使用规范化的命名规则,方便代码的阅读和维护。
(2)编写清晰的注释,提高代码的可读性。
(3)遵循模块化编程原则,提高代码的可重用性。
数控系统编程是一项技术性较强的工作,需要从业人员具备扎实的理论基础和实践经验。通过掌握以上要点,编程人员可以编写出高质量的G代码,为数控机床的加工提供有力保障。在实际工作中,编程人员还需不断学习新技术、新工艺,提高自身综合素质,为我国制造业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。